ResoundingBuahaha;n9153360 said:Reason is simple, weather is still good bronze card and not even close to awful card. With Harpy being the best bronze card (21 maximum, 13 minimum gain) and bear don't automatically clear the eggs. Don't even know how reaver is complained in this post. In best case a single reaver can reach 16 after 4 reaver has been played but harpy can produce 21 without too much effort. If we are talking about power swing I say harpy should be nerfed more than anything else
Bassario;n9153400 said:Disagree. Harpy is fine and weather is fine. The foglets thin the deck too efficiently, you dont even need to hold a single one in hand unlike other muster/thinning effects. This and the use of Ge'els allows that dagon deck to pick up both triss and yen with extreme consistency so it is easy to win 2 rounds all while having very good carry over. I like thinning effects very much because they separate the good and bad players, knowing your odds and playing to your outs is so important but this deck is just too damn consistent and that makes it OP.
